The Nasdaq (National Association of Securities Dealers Automated Quotations) was founded in 1971 as an electronic stock market. Its initial focus was on over-the-counter (OTC) trading, allowing companies to trade their shares directly with each other without the need for a physical exchange. Over the years, Nasdaq has grown exponentially, becoming the second-largest stock exchange in the world by market capitalization.
Today, Nasdaq is home to over 3,800 listed companies, including some of the most renowned technology giants such as Apple, Microsoft, Amazon, and Google. These companies represent a diverse range of industries, including technology, healthcare, financial services, and retail.
The Nasdaq has had a profound impact on the global economy and financial markets. Its focus on innovation and technology has fueled entrepreneurialism and the growth of tech startups. The exchange's transparent and efficient trading platform has also enhanced investor confidence and liquidity in the markets.
Moreover, Nasdaq's global reach has created a seamless investment environment, allowing investors to access companies from various countries. This has fostered cross-border capital flows and stimulated economic development.
